> I am trying to understand the various stats available in the stats.txt
> file for the Hello World binary under O3 configuration.
> Specifically, I am looking at the folder
> <gem5_path>/tests/quick/se/00.hello/ref/arm/linux/o3-timing.
>
>
> Here the total committed instruction count is mentioned as
>
> system.cpu.commit.committedInsts                 4591
>   # Number of instructions committed
> system.cpu.commit.committedOps                   5729
>   # Number of ops (including micro ops) committed
>
>
> with the other stats listed below.
>
> system.cpu.commit.swp_count                         0
>   # Number of s/w prefetches committed
> system.cpu.commit.refs                           2138
>   # Number of memory references committed
> system.cpu.commit.loads                          1200
>   # Number of loads committed
> system.cpu.commit.membars                          12
>   # Number of memory barriers committed
> system.cpu.commit.branches                       1007
>   # Number of branches committed
> system.cpu.commit.fp_insts                         16
>   # Number of committed floating point instructions.
> system.cpu.commit.int_insts                      4976
>   # Number of committed integer instructions.
> system.cpu.commit.function_calls                   82
>   # Number of function calls committed.
> system.cpu.commit.bw_lim_events                   119
>   # number cycles where commit BW limit reached
>
> Now, to calculate the final instruction count, I would calculate the
> following sum : int_insts + fp_insts + branches + refs = 4976+16+1007+2138
> = 8137, which does not match either committedInsts or committedOps.
> Am I missing something here  ?
